Abstract

This article presents exact and approximate solutions of the seventh order time-fractional Lax’s Korteweg–de Vries (7TfLKdV) and Sawada–Kotera (7TfSK) equations using the modification of the homotopy analysis method called the q-homotopy analysis method. Using this method, we construct the solutions to these problems in the form of recurrence relations and present the graphical representation to verify all obtained results in each case for different values of fractional order. Error analysis is also illustrated in the present investigation.
